Materials & durability — how it stands up to daily life
Tungsten carbide is one of the hardest materials used in jewelry. In practical terms this means:
- Exceptional scratch resistance — the gold inlay will show more wear than the tungsten edges, but everyday scuffs and knocks should be minimal.
- Low maintenance — no polishing required to keep the silver-toned tungsten looking new.
- Note on brittleness — tungsten carbide can be brittle if struck with extreme force. It resists scratches but can crack if dropped onto hard surfaces.
For most buyers seeking a durable wedding band or a stylish everyday ring, tungsten’s advantages outweigh the small risk of damage from heavy impact.
Sizing & fit — choose the right width and size
The Sinatra Ring is available across a wide range of sizes and three widths. Practical tips:
- If you prefer a bold look or have larger hands, start with the 8mm width.
- For a subtle wedding band or slim-fingered wearers, the 4mm or 6mm options are a better fit.
- Comfort fit helps if you toggle ring sizes slightly between seasons (hands swell in heat).
